body{--tw-bg-opacity:1;background-color:rgb(255 255 255/var(--tw-bg-opacity,1));--tw-text-opacity:1;color:rgb(50 50 67/var(--tw-text-opacity,1))}body:is(.dark *){--tw-bg-opacity:1;background-color:rgb(17 25 40/var(--tw-bg-opacity,1));--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}.content h1,.content h2,.content h3,.content h4,.content h5,.content h6{font-weight:700}.content h1:is(.dark *),.content h2:is(.dark *),.content h3:is(.dark *),.content h4:is(.dark *),.content h5:is(.dark *),.content h6:is(.dark *){--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}.content li,.content p,.content td{font-size:1.125rem;line-height:1.75rem}.content li:is(.dark *),.content p:is(.dark *),.content td:is(.dark *){--tw-text-opacity:1;color:rgb(205 203 211/var(--tw-text-opacity,1))}.content Strong:is(.dark *),.content code:is(.dark *){--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}.content h1{font-size:1.875rem;line-height:2.25rem}@media (min-width:640px){.content h1{font-size:2.25rem;line-height:2.5rem}}@media (min-width:768px){.content h1{font-size:3rem;line-height:1}}.content h2{font-size:1.5rem;line-height:2rem}@media (min-width:640px){.content h2{font-size:1.875rem;line-height:2.25rem}}@media (min-width:768px){.content h2{font-size:2.25rem;line-height:2.5rem}}.content h3{font-size:1.25rem;line-height:1.75rem}@media (min-width:640px){.content h3{font-size:1.5rem;line-height:2rem}}@media (min-width:768px){.content h3{font-size:1.875rem;line-height:2.25rem}}.content a{font-weight:600;--tw-text-opacity:1;color:rgb(37 97 118/var(--tw-text-opacity,1));transition-property:color,background-color,border-color,text-decoration-color,fill,stroke,opacity,box-shadow,transform,filter,backdrop-filter;transition-timing-function:cubic-bezier(.4,0,.2,1);transition-duration:.3s}.content a:hover{--tw-text-opacity:1;color:rgb(0 42 57/var(--tw-text-opacity,1));text-decoration-line:underline}.content a:hover:is(.dark *){color:rgba(37,97,118,.8)}.nav-link{display:block;border-radius:.5rem;padding:.5rem .75rem;font-weight:600}.group:hover .nav-link{--tw-text-opacity:1;color:rgb(37 97 118/var(--tw-text-opacity,1))}.group:hover .nav-link:is(.dark *){background-color:rgba(37,97,118,.2);--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}@media (min-width:1280px){.nav-link{padding-left:1.25rem;padding-right:1.25rem}}.active-nav-link{--tw-text-opacity:1;color:rgb(37 97 118/var(--tw-text-opacity,1))}.btn-primary{display:inline-flex;width:100%;justify-content:center;border-radius:.375rem;padding:.625rem 1rem;font-weight:600;--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}@media (min-width:640px){.btn-primary{width:auto}}.btn-primary{background-image:linear-gradient(270deg,#256176,#217386,#1c8594,#1c97a0,#25aaaa)}.btn-outline-primary{display:inline-flex;width:100%;justify-content:center;border-radius:.375rem;border-width:1px;--tw-border-opacity:1;border-color:rgb(37 97 118/var(--tw-border-opacity,1));--tw-bg-opacity:1;background-color:rgb(255 255 255/var(--tw-bg-opacity,1));padding:.625rem 1rem;font-weight:600;--tw-text-opacity:1;color:rgb(37 97 118/var(--tw-text-opacity,1))}.btn-outline-primary:hover{--tw-bg-opacity:1;background-color:rgb(37 97 118/var(--tw-bg-opacity,1));--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}@media (min-width:640px){.btn-outline-primary{width:auto}}.btn-secondary{display:inline-flex;width:100%;justify-content:center;border-radius:.375rem;border-width:1px;--tw-border-opacity:1;border-color:rgb(231 231 233/var(--tw-border-opacity,1));background-color:transparent;padding:.625rem 1rem;font-weight:600;--tw-text-opacity:1;color:rgb(0 42 57/var(--tw-text-opacity,1));--tw-backdrop-blur:blur(8px);-webkit-backdrop-filter:var(--tw-backdrop-blur) var(--tw-backdrop-brightness) var(--tw-backdrop-contrast) var(--tw-backdrop-grayscale) var(--tw-backdrop-hue-rotate) var(--tw-backdrop-invert) var(--tw-backdrop-opacity) var(--tw-backdrop-saturate) var(--tw-backdrop-sepia);backdrop-filter:var(--tw-backdrop-blur) var(--tw-backdrop-brightness) var(--tw-backdrop-contrast) var(--tw-backdrop-grayscale) var(--tw-backdrop-hue-rotate) var(--tw-backdrop-invert) var(--tw-backdrop-opacity) var(--tw-backdrop-saturate) var(--tw-backdrop-sepia)}.btn-secondary:hover{background-color:hsla(0,0%,100%,.5)}.btn-secondary:is(.dark *){border-color:hsla(240,4%,91%,.2);--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}.btn-secondary:is(.dark *):hover{background-color:hsla(0,0%,100%,.1)}@media (min-width:640px){.btn-secondary{width:auto}}.theme-btn-primary{display:flex;flex:1 1 0%;align-items:center;justify-content:center;gap:.5rem;border-radius:.375rem;border-width:1px;border-color:rgba(37,97,118,.3);background-color:rgba(37,97,118,.05);padding:.625rem 1rem;--tw-text-opacity:1;color:rgb(37 97 118/var(--tw-text-opacity,1))}.theme-btn-primary:hover{--tw-bg-opacity:1;background-color:rgb(37 97 118/var(--tw-bg-opacity,1));--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}.theme-btn-primary:is(.dark *){--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}.theme-btn-primary:hover{border-left-width:0;border-right-width:0;background-image:linear-gradient(270deg,#256176,#217386,#1c8594,#1c97a0,#25aaaa)}.theme-btn-secondary{display:flex;flex:1 1 0%;align-items:center;justify-content:center;gap:.5rem;border-radius:.375rem;border-width:1px;border-color:rgba(37,97,118,.3);--tw-bg-opacity:1;background-color:rgb(255 255 255/var(--tw-bg-opacity,1));padding:.625rem 1rem;--tw-text-opacity:1;color:rgb(37 97 118/var(--tw-text-opacity,1))}.theme-btn-secondary:hover{--tw-bg-opacity:1;background-color:rgb(37 97 118/var(--tw-bg-opacity,1));--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}.theme-btn-secondary:is(.dark *){background-color:transparent;--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}.theme-btn-secondary:hover{border-left-width:0;border-right-width:0;background-image:linear-gradient(270deg,#256176,#217386,#1c8594,#1c97a0,#25aaaa)}.btn-tertiary{display:flex;width:100%;align-items:center;justify-content:center;border-radius:.375rem;border-width:2px;border-color:rgba(37,97,118,.2);padding:.625rem 1rem;font-weight:700;--tw-text-opacity:1;color:rgb(37 97 118/var(--tw-text-opacity,1));transition-property:color,background-color,border-color,text-decoration-color,fill,stroke,opacity,box-shadow,transform,filter,backdrop-filter;transition-timing-function:cubic-bezier(.4,0,.2,1);transition-duration:.2s}.btn-tertiary:hover{border-color:rgba(37,97,118,.4);background-color:rgba(37,97,118,.05)}.btn-tertiary:is(.dark *){--tw-bg-opacity:1;background-color:rgb(31 42 55/var(--tw-bg-opacity,1))}.login-container{display:flex;justify-content:center;align-items:center;min-height:100vh;background-color:#f5f5f5;padding:20px}.login-box{background:#fff;padding:40px;border-radius:10px;box-shadow:0 0 20px rgba(0,0,0,.1);width:100%;max-width:400px}.login-header{text-align:center;margin-bottom:30px}.login-header h2{color:#333;font-size:24px;margin-bottom:8px}.login-header p{color:#666;font-size:14px}.login-form{gap:20px}.form-group,.login-form{display:flex;flex-direction:column}.form-group{gap:8px}.form-group label{color:#333;font-size:14px;font-weight:500}.input-group{border:1px solid #ddd;border-radius:6px;overflow:hidden}.form-group input{padding:12px;font-size:14px;outline:none;transition:border-color .3s ease}.form-group .input-group:focus-within{--tw-border-opacity:1;border-color:rgb(37 97 118/var(--tw-border-opacity,1));box-shadow:0 0 0 2px rgba(74,144,226,.1)}.password-field{position:relative}.toggle-password{font-size:12px;padding:4px 8px}.remember-me{display:flex;align-items:center;gap:8px}.remember-me input[type=checkbox]{width:16px;height:16px;cursor:pointer}.remember-me label{color:#666;font-size:14px;cursor:pointer}.toggle-password{position:absolute;right:12px;top:50%;transform:translateY(-50%);background:none;border:none;color:#666;cursor:pointer;padding:4px;display:flex;align-items:center;justify-content:center}.toggle-password:hover{color:#333}.toggle-password svg{width:20px;height:20px}@media (max-width:480px){.login-box{padding:20px}.login-header h2{font-size:20px}.form-group input{padding:10px}}.menu-scroll{border-color:transparent;color:#637381}.menu-scroll:hover{border-color:#3758f9}.menu-scroll:is(.dark *){color:#6b7280}.menu-scroll.active{border-color:#3758f9;color:#3758f9}.dashboard-container{min-height:100vh;padding-left:1.5rem;padding-right:1.5rem}@media (min-width:768px){.dashboard-container{margin-left:16rem}}pre{height:inherit}.custom-primary-shadow{box-shadow:0 0 16px rgba(17,17,26,.1)}.custom-secondary-shadow{box-shadow:0 0 0 0 rgba(14,63,126,.04),0 1px 1px -.5px rgba(42,51,69,.04),0 3px 3px -1.5px rgba(42,51,70,.04),0 6px 6px -3px rgba(42,51,70,.04),0 12px 12px -6px rgba(14,63,126,.04),0 24px 24px -12px rgba(14,63,126,.04)}.theme-sidebar{position:fixed;left:0;top:82px;z-index:20;height:92vh;width:18rem;--tw-translate-x:0px;transform:translate(var(--tw-translate-x),var(--tw-translate-y)) rotate(var(--tw-rotate)) skewX(var(--tw-skew-x)) skewY(var(--tw-skew-y)) scaleX(var(--tw-scale-x)) scaleY(var(--tw-scale-y));overflow-y:auto;overscroll-behavior-y:auto;border-left-width:1px;--tw-border-opacity:1;border-color:rgb(231 231 233/var(--tw-border-opacity,1));--tw-bg-opacity:1;background-color:rgb(255 255 255/var(--tw-bg-opacity,1));padding-top:1.5rem;padding-bottom:1.5rem;transition-property:transform;transition-duration:.3s;transition-timing-function:cubic-bezier(.4,0,.2,1)}.theme-sidebar:is(.dark *){border-color:hsla(240,4%,91%,.2);--tw-bg-opacity:1;background-color:rgb(31 42 55/var(--tw-bg-opacity,1));--tw-text-opacity:1;color:rgb(205 203 211/var(--tw-text-opacity,1))}@media (min-width:640px){.theme-sidebar{width:20rem}}@media (min-width:1024px){.theme-sidebar{position:sticky;z-index:0}}.theme-sidebar::-webkit-scrollbar-thumb{background-color:rgba(37,97,118,.2)}.theme-sidebar:is(.dark *)::-webkit-scrollbar-thumb{background-color:rgba(37,97,118,.5)}.theme-sidebar::-webkit-scrollbar-track{background-color:rgba(37,97,118,.1)}.theme-sidebar:is(.dark *)::-webkit-scrollbar-track{background-color:rgba(248,249,250,.1)}.theme-sidebar::-webkit-scrollbar{width:.375rem}.compo-sidebar{position:fixed;left:0;top:180px;z-index:20;margin-top:1.5rem;height:100%;width:100%;--tw-translate-x:0px;transform:translate(var(--tw-translate-x),var(--tw-translate-y)) rotate(var(--tw-rotate)) skewX(var(--tw-skew-x)) skewY(var(--tw-skew-y)) scaleX(var(--tw-scale-x)) scaleY(var(--tw-scale-y));overflow-y:auto;overscroll-behavior-y:auto;--tw-bg-opacity:1;background-color:rgb(255 255 255/var(--tw-bg-opacity,1));padding:1rem 1rem 11rem;transition-property:transform;transition-duration:.3s;transition-timing-function:cubic-bezier(.4,0,.2,1)}.compo-sidebar:is(.dark *){--tw-bg-opacity:1;background-color:rgb(31 42 55/var(--tw-bg-opacity,1));--tw-text-opacity:1;color:rgb(205 203 211/var(--tw-text-opacity,1))}@media (min-width:1024px){.compo-sidebar{position:static;z-index:0;margin-top:0;height:88%;padding-bottom:7rem}}.compo-sidebar::-webkit-scrollbar-thumb{background-color:rgba(37,97,118,.2)}.compo-sidebar:is(.dark *)::-webkit-scrollbar-thumb{background-color:rgba(37,97,118,.5)}.compo-sidebar::-webkit-scrollbar-track{background-color:rgba(37,97,118,.1)}.compo-sidebar:is(.dark *)::-webkit-scrollbar-track{background-color:rgba(248,249,250,.1)}.compo-sidebar::-webkit-scrollbar{width:.375rem}.tools-bar-scroll-design::-webkit-scrollbar-thumb{background-color:rgba(37,97,118,.2)}.tools-bar-scroll-design:is(.dark *)::-webkit-scrollbar-thumb{background-color:rgba(37,97,118,.5)}.tools-bar-scroll-design::-webkit-scrollbar-track{background-color:rgba(37,97,118,.1)}.tools-bar-scroll-design:is(.dark *)::-webkit-scrollbar-track{background-color:rgba(248,249,250,.1)}.tools-bar-scroll-design::-webkit-scrollbar{width:.375rem}.pre-code-scroll-design::-webkit-scrollbar-thumb{background-color:rgba(37,97,118,.2)}.pre-code-scroll-design:is(.dark *)::-webkit-scrollbar-thumb{background-color:rgba(37,97,118,.5)}.pre-code-scroll-design::-webkit-scrollbar-track{background-color:rgba(37,97,118,.1)}.pre-code-scroll-design:is(.dark *)::-webkit-scrollbar-track{background-color:rgba(248,249,250,.1)}.pre-code-scroll-design::-webkit-scrollbar{height:.25rem}.blue-badge{background-color:rgb(59 130 246/var(--tw-bg-opacity,1))}.blue-badge,.primary-badge{display:inline-block;border-radius:.5rem;--tw-bg-opacity:1;padding:.625rem 1.5rem;font-weight:700;--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}.primary-badge{background-color:rgb(37 97 118/var(--tw-bg-opacity,1))}.green-badge{background-color:rgb(34 197 94/var(--tw-bg-opacity,1))}.green-badge,.red-badge{display:inline-block;border-radius:.5rem;--tw-bg-opacity:1;padding:.625rem 1.5rem;font-weight:700;--tw-text-opacity:1;color:rgb(255 255 255/var(--tw-text-opacity,1))}.red-badge{background-color:rgb(239 68 68/var(--tw-bg-opacity,1))}.changelog ul li strong{--tw-text-opacity:1;color:rgb(37 97 118/var(--tw-text-opacity,1))}.changelog ul li strong:is(.dark *){--tw-text-opacity:1;color:rgb(37 170 170/var(--tw-text-opacity,1))}input:-webkit-autofill{background:transparent!important;-webkit-box-shadow:inset 0 0 0 1000px #fff!important;-webkit-text-fill-color:#000!important;transition:background-color 5000s ease-in-out 0s}.dark input:-webkit-autofill{background:transparent!important;-webkit-box-shadow:inset 0 0 0 1000px #111928!important;-webkit-text-fill-color:#fff!important}input::-webkit-inner-spin-button,input::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}input[type=number]{-moz-appearance:textfield}#color-picker::-webkit-color-swatch{border-radius:20%}input[type=range]::-webkit-slider-thumb{-webkit-appearance:none;margin-top:0;height:20px;width:20px;border-radius:9999px;border-style:none;--tw-bg-opacity:1;background-color:rgb(37 97 118/var(--tw-bg-opacity,1))}input[type=range]::-moz-range-thumb{margin-top:0;height:20px;width:20px;border-radius:9999px;border-style:none;--tw-bg-opacity:1;background-color:rgb(37 97 118/var(--tw-bg-opacity,1))}@keyframes blobFloat{0%{transform:translate(-50%,-50%) scale(1);border-radius:70% 30% 80% 20%/60% 40% 30% 70%}25%{transform:translate(-50%,-50%) scale(1.07);border-radius:20% 80% 40% 60%/65% 35% 75% 25%}50%{transform:translate(-50%,-50%) scale(1.1);border-radius:85% 20% 60% 40%/40% 80% 20% 60%}75%{transform:translate(-50%,-50%) scale(1.05);border-radius:25% 75% 35% 65%/70% 20% 80% 30%}to{transform:translate(-50%,-50%) scale(1);border-radius:70% 30% 80% 20%/60% 40% 30% 70%}}.blob-animation{background-color:rgba(37,97,118,.1)}.blob-animation:is(.dark *){background-color:hsla(0,0%,100%,.1)}.blob-animation{position:absolute;top:45px;left:45px;width:80px;height:80px;border-radius:45%;animation:blobFloat 6s ease-in-out infinite;z-index:0;pointer-events:none}@keyframes slide-up{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.animate-slide-up{animation:slide-up .4s ease-out forwards}@keyframes slide-in{0%{opacity:0;transform:translateX(50px)}to{opacity:1;transform:translateX(0)}}.animate-slide-in{animation:slide-in .4s ease-out forwards}@keyframes fade-in-down{0%{opacity:0;transform:translateY(-15px)}to{opacity:1;transform:translateY(0)}}.animate-fade-in-down{animation:fade-in-down .4s ease-out forwards}